In their place. — ‘Omdâm. This word is used in this sense only in Daniel, Chronicles, Nehemiah. (Comp. 2 Chronicles 34:31; 2 Chronicles 35:10.)

After their manner — i.e., “according to their order” (1 Chronicles 6:31).

According to the law ... of God. — Another reference to the Pentateuchal legislation. (See 2 Chronicles 23:18; 2 Chronicles 24:6; 2 Chronicles 14:4; 2 Chronicles 17:9.)

Sprinkled... Levites. — Rather, sprinkling the blood from the hand of the Levites. On this occasion the Levites, and not the laymen who presented the victims, slew the lambs and handed the blood to the priests to be dashed against the altar. The reason of this breach of the ordinary rule is given in next verse.
